Output c895cc7406a338ba2e168dc52c33f5b9c5c9de200aa449010b62ab655c221726:2

value
127597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35aaeba2b6e0c4339c2e91ea420762a6d739d01d OP_EQUAL
address
36anVUKrKybzFK1sHDbDcK2KM6xjvqE17i
transaction
c895cc7406a338ba2e168dc52c33f5b9c5c9de200aa449010b62ab655c221726
spent
true